Recommendation: Always take a minimum of 9 flat armor on junglers. No exceptions. Your choice where you take it; you could take armor quints or marks on some junglers, but with Lee Sin this decision is easy.

Yes, Thresh made a horrible mistake. But you should always have flat armor seals, especially on Lee Sin, because earlygame is pretty much everything for him.

As a Lee Sin, you should not have had to recall at level 2 through intelligent usage of your W. There are champions that are ruined by a lost gromp and must recall such as Evelyn, but Lee Sin's lifesteal/spell steal provides him enough that you have cleared the jungle . Albeit with more difficulty but it can be done.

I do agree, however, that the Thresh could have paid attention better and not taken your gromp. It should not, however, make you useless especially as Lee Sin
